6.The potential-pH diagrams for magnetite-water and zinc ferrite-water systems at 25℃ and 100℃ have been constructed, by which we can explain thermodynamically the experimental result of zinc calcine hot acid leach, i.e, high temperature (1100℃) zinc calcine is much easier to leach than ordinary zinc calcine.
7.A test has been made for extrating Sc from magnanese ore by employing a chemical concentration process which consists of steps as sulphuric acid leach, extraction of the leach liquor, extraction of Sc from the organic phase, recovery of Co and Ni from residual extracted liquor and preparation of manganese carbonate from the pruified liquor.
8.Iron oxide black pigment, magnetite powder for the production of toner, cobalt-modified magnetite powder for magnetic recording were prepared from pyrite cinder. Our study was concentrated on the oxidation precipitation of magnetite, control of size and shape, surface chemical properties of magnetite, surface modification and magnetic properties of cobalt- modified magnetite powder. Using sulfuric acid to leach pyrite cinder, pyrite was used to reduce acid-leaching solution for the first time.
